channel setup with other frequencies
In Holland not all TV channels use the predefined fixed frequencies.
They also use frequencies a bit lower or higher then the fixed channels, like 58- or 47+. In most tuners you can find these channels with autotuning, or with manual finetuning (like WinTV2000). How can this be done with Sage? There is no manual finetuning option and autotuning does not find these channels. Thanks Barrie |

The solution to this problem is edit the registry key
hkey local machine/software/mirosoft/tv system services/tvautotune and then TSO-0 antenne or TS0-1 cable it doesn't mather wich one you use. The keys TS31-0 and TS31-1(different numbers for each country) should be empty. now you can manually enter the channel in the order you want for example Nederland 1 216 mhz in Amsterdam put in key 01 and decimal value 216000000. now in your program don't preform autotune but select cable or antenne manually put in 01 and that will be Nederland 1. I have found this solution some time ago on the internet and it works for me. I hope this helps I can send you my registry key but it will have my preset order and only work in Amsterdam on UPC cable as long as they don't change the channels and they will from time to time. Thanks, i finally got this worked out!
I remapped the channels as described above and than changed in the registry the frequencies of the channels that do not correspond with the fixed channels (eg RTL 5 is channel 58- and corresponds with frequency 764,25 instead of channel 58 with frequency 767,25 ) From the Microsoft site i now understand that there is a fixed table for Western Europe, so you only have to change the channels you want to remap or the ones where the frequency is not right.
